Been reported that CGM has a high ankle sprain. That is a lingering injury. It's actually a tear. This can linger an entire season if he rushes back. High ankle sprains basically destroy a player's ability to cut hard on that leg. I hope they keep him on the sideline until healed, even if that takes 4-6 weeks.
